Hypertension, commonly known as high blood pressure, is a chronic medical cond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It occurs when the force of blood against the artery walls is consistently too high, leading to serious health complications such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ney problems. Managing Hypertension requires regular medical check-ups, medication adherence, and lifestyle modifications.
